Vice President Lin Yi Interviewed by China Traffic Radio
To highlight the forthcoming 2018 Beijing Summit of the Forum on China-Africa Cooperation, China Traffic Radio is launching a series of special programs. On 24 August, Madame Lin Yi, Vice President of CPAFFC, received an interview by China Traffic Radio and made brief introduction on CPAFFC’s endeavors in promoting local governments, youth and cultural exchanges with Africa.
Madame Lin said that CPAFFC held the Job Fair for African Students in November of 2017 and proposed the establishment of the China-Africa Local Governments union of TVET (Technical & Vocational Education & Training) Cooperation during the Third Forum on China-Africa Local Government Cooperation hosted in Beijing in May 2018. The aim is to improve technical skills for young Africans, promote their employment and provide competent personnel resources to Chinese companies in Africa.
Besides, on the purpose of strengthening the interaction between Chinese and African people, CPAFFC has hosted three dragon boat festive events in Egypt and Uganda which were well-received by local residents and played an active role in promoting cultural exchanges and friendship between China and Africa.

The Sixth China-Germany U16 Youth Football Friendship Tournament Held Successfully in Qingdao
The Sixth China-Germany U16 Youth Football Friendship Tournament jointly organized by CPAFFC and Friendship Association Mannheim/Rhein-Neckar in Germany was successfully held in Qingdao, Shandong Province from August 2nd to August 13th . CPAFFC Vice-President Song Jingwu attended the event.
Team Waldhof and Team Waldorf from Mannheim competed with No.1 High School Qingdao, Qingdao Experimental High School, Yiwu 11th High School and The Huis' Middle School of Shenyang. Finally Team Waldorf, Team Waldhof and Qingdao Experimental High School won respectively the Top 3 of the Tournament.
On the evening of August 10th, over 150 youth from both countries gathered for the Sino-German Youth Night of Friendship in the Qingdao Sino-German Ecological Park. After 10 days of competition and being together, the young players communicated with each other and established a deep friendship among them using football as a language.
Vice-president Song Jingwu. Vice-Mayor of Qingdao, former German head coach of Chinese Men National Soccer Team Klaus Schlappner, city councilor of Mannheim Andrea Safferling attended the closing ceremony and the Night of Friendship.
